ON Semiconductor NCP333FCT2G Product Overview
The ON Semiconductor NCP333FCT2G is a high-performance, low dropout voltage regulator designed to deliver a stable and reliable power supply in a wide range of applications. This regulator is capable of providing an output current of up to 300 mA, making it suitable for powering sensitive electronic devices that require a constant and precise voltage.
Key Features
- Output Voltage: The NCP333FCT2G offers a fixed output voltage, providing excellent regulation and stability.
- Low Dropout Voltage: It features a low dropout voltage, ensuring efficient operation even when the input voltage is close to the output voltage.
- High Output Accuracy: This regulator provides high output voltage accuracy, which is essential for applications that demand precise voltage levels.
- Thermal Shutdown and Current Limit Protection: The device includes built-in thermal shutdown and current limit features to protect against over-temperature and over-current conditions.
- Wide Operating Temperature Range: The NCP333FCT2G is designed to operate over a broad temperature range, making it suitable for industrial and automotive applications.
- Surface Mount Package: The device is available in a compact, surface-mount package, which is ideal for space-constrained applications.
Applications
The versatility of the NCP333FCT2G makes it an excellent choice for a variety of applications, including:
- Portable and battery-powered devices
- Microcontroller power supplies
- Wireless communication devices
- Consumer electronics
- Automotive systems
